S7-200SMART库中为什么会有两个Modbus RTU Master。能举例说明吗?

S7-200SMART库中为什么会有两个Modbus RTU Master。能举例说明吗?

钻石用户推荐最佳答案

CPU 本体口和通讯板可以同时作为MODBUS RTU 主站,不能同时做为从站。
当两个口都作为主站时,则对于单个 Modbus RTU 主站,使用指令 MBUS_CTRL 和 MBUS_MSG 配对对一个主站口编程
对于第二个 Modbus RTU 主站,使用指令 MBUS_CTRL2 和 MBUS_MSG2 配对对其编程。
两组指令用法相同,就是同时作为主站时,每组各针对一个主站口。
如图,截自系统手册
系统手册链接
https://support.industry.siemens.com/cs/document/109745610
S7-200 SMART Modbus通信常见问题
http://www.ad.siemens.com.cn/productportal/Prods/s7-200-smart-portal/200SmartTop/SmartSMS/020.html

图片说明:

S7-200SMART库中为什么会有两个Modbus RTU Master。能举例说明吗?  

提问者对于答案的评价:

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c280667.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2020年10月30日
下一篇 2020年10月30日

相关推荐